Study on the Treatment of HER2-negative Breast Cancer Brain Metastases With Radiotherapy Combined With Anlotinib
Phase 2 trial testing Radiotherapy Combined with Anlotinib and a Microtubule Inhibitor in HER2-Negative Breast Cancer in 39 participants. Currently enrolling.

Sponsor's own description
Angiogenesis inhibition represents a significant therapeutic target in breast cancer; however, despite its theoretical feasibility, progress in advanced breast cancer has been slow. Currently, there is a lack of prospective data supporting the selection of tyrosine kinase inhibitors (TKIs) in combination with local therapy. This phase II study aims to evaluate the efficacy and safety of stereotactic radiotherapy (SRT) or whole-brain radiotherapy (WBRT) combined with anlotinib in patients with HER2-negative advanced breast cancer and brain metastases.
